Bettye Mae Jack Middle School

Science Proficiency

Percent of students scoring Proficient or Advanced (Levels 4 or 5) on the statewide Science or Biology I assessment.

Science Proficiency Overview

State
District
School

Mississippi

60.7%

Scott County School District

53.6%

Bettye Mae Jack Middle School

37.6%
